Mobile network enables mobile nodes to pass over multiple base stations based on handover authentication protocol. Achieving security and efficiency are the main challenges to this process. The existing protocols for handover authentication have high communication and computational cost. The proposed protocol pairhand uses pairing based cryptography. Key compromise problem exists because of the assumption about trusted third party. An enhancement identity based security mechanism is proposed for achieving more efficiency and security without losing any feature of pair hand. The bilinear pairhand is an advanced approach as it verifies the identity based encryption method and rejects the unauthorized one.
